Lionel Blackman.

Stood for Independent in Epsom and Ewell at the 2015 General Election. Not elected — so there is no parliamentary record to show, but here is the contest in full and where the seat stands now.

Finished 6th of 7 with 612 votes (1.1%).

The result in full · 2015 General Election

CandidatePartyVotesShare
Chris Grayling✓ electedCon33,30958.3%
Sheila CarlsonLab8,86615.5%
Robert Leach7,11712.4%
Stephen GeeLD5,0028.8%
Susan McGrathGreen2,1163.7%
Lionel BlackmanInd6121.1%
Gareth HarfootInd1210.2%

Majority 24,443 · 57,143 votes cast.
